Job Description
Perform duties to devise methods for machining parts, prototypes, and short run jobs.
Work from drawings, process sheets, table charts, and verbal instructions.
Perform prototype work, difficult machining operations, and short runs. Other duties will involve drill and endmill sharpening as well as issuing tooling.
Draw, sketch, construct, alter, repair, make tool tryouts, diagnose and correct problems.
Adapt cam, jury rig fixture, or tooling to handle special and short run jobs. Perform diversified, internal, external, surface grinding operations on prototype, short run, and the like following standard practice or special instructions.
Use precision measuring instruments and equipment of the trade. Move materials as necessary in the performance of duties. Detect, report improper operation, faulty equipment, defective materials and unusual conditions to supervisor or maintenance personnel.
Maintain work area and equipment in clean and orderly condition.
Follow all safety practices; maintain safety features on all machinery.
Perform other job related duties as required or directed.
This position will require expertise in CNC turning and milling.
